EU exit by next election
LIAM Fox has insisted it is “not a huge deal” if transitional arrangements for Brexit last up until 2022.
But the International Trade Secretary said he believed people did not want it “dragging on” so long.
He told BBC One’s The Andrew Marr Show: “Having waited for over 40 years to leave the European Union, 24 months would be a rounding error. It’s not a huge deal and neither is it an ideological one.
“I think we would want to get it out of the way before the election.”
But the Federation of Germany industry, the BDI, warned against a long transitional deal.
